Imaging Technologist - Cardiac
ICON plc is a world-leading healthcare intelligence and clinical research organization. We’re proud to foster an inclusive environment driving innovation and excellence, and we welcome you to join us on our mission to shape the future of clinical development.
The Incoming Imaging Technologist is responsible for receiving, logging, preparing, loading, quality inspecting, and/or identifying/resolving incoming data issues for clinical data received by ICON as well as to support research, reconciliations, peer coverage, and/or other tasks as needed.
This position is responsible for completing the required tasks each day as well as providing training and mentoring to team members and new hires.
